We have 40 beautiful acres on The Snowy River Way in Jindabyne with several large, private sites. Groups are welcome to have their own spot together and each site has a fire pit. We are only 10 minutes from Lake Jindabyne – turn left to head up to the mountains (a further 30 minutes to Thredbo or Perisher) or right to explore Jindabyne township and its boutiques, breweries, cafes and cinema. Stop in at The Station Resort on the way back from the mountains, just five minutes away for a nice feed and game of pool (during winter). Our property is on a hill with a dam midway up if you’re looking for a nice walk. Do a loop for spectacular views! Come and enjoy the beautiful outlook and natural wildlife. Rest in peace and privacy or get out to enjoy all the Snowy Mountains has to offer. Whether you come for snow sports, water sports, biking, hiking, yoga or reading – adventure and relaxation awaits. Access to all sites is via a tree-lined driveway. To get to the western paddock and Sunset, Pine View and Hilltop sites, the turn off the drive to get through the fence means that small to medium setups are suitable. To get to the eastern paddock and Sunrise and Birch Grove sites, the turn off the driveway is a bit wider to allow for larger setups. Please check the details for size recommendations – the maximum sizes listed are for your total setup, including your car and anything towed. The sites at the bottom of the property closest to the road have easy access and more protection in windy weather, but if you have a 4WD and are wanting to sit and enjoy the 360 degree rural views then head up the hill to our Hilltop site. We can supply firewood, kindling and fire starters for a small fee, just message us in advance, or you can BYO. Strictly no foraging for wood from the property please. There’s also no power hookups, taps or toilets so it's fully self-sufficient camping. For the peace of other campers, we don't allow generators or pets, sorry. Sunset

100%
(31)
RV/tent site · Sleeps 10 · Vehicles under 10 m
This site is on the western side of the property and perfect to enjoy a large campfire, afternoon sun, and amazing views with snow-capped mountains in winter. Vehicles may be passing to get to other campsites but guests will have approximately 500sqm of grassy space to set up on and a few acres of land to enjoy in peace and privacy. ** Please note that the maximum overall length per setup is recommended as 10 metres or less – that includes your vehicle and anything towed.

Hilltop

100%
(19)
RV/tent site · Sleeps 10 · Vehicles under 9 m
This site has spectacular views from the top of Harros Hill. It is the most exposed site when the wind picks up, and it's recommended to have a 4WD to climb the steep, gravel path up the hill – but the views are worth it!! Access is not too tricky, long or dangerous – it just helps to have a capable car – especially if it's wet and slippery or you're towing something. Heavy loads not recommended.

Birch Grove

100%
(17)
RV/tent site · Sleeps 10 · Vehicles under 13 m
Access to this site is by turning left off the drive, crossing a grassy field and dry gully to camp on the paddock on the eastern side of the property. Birch trees frame the site and give full privacy for you to enjoy sunrise vistas and a few acres of space.

Pine View

97%
(15)
RV/tent site · Sleeps 8 · Vehicles under 10 m
Camp near the row of pines on the western boundary with a beautiful outlook looking across to snow capped mountains in winter. This campsite is easily accessible with a large, gently sloping grass area and full privacy. There is a dry gully and large empty dam bordering the site – neither will fill with water again unfortunately because the water has been diverted upstream but it means kids are safe to explore!
